- 1、本文档共10页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E
1-
维普毕业设计(论文)管理系统
一、系统概述
系统概述
(1)维普毕业设计(论文)管理系统是针对高校毕业设计(论文)全过程进行管理的信息化平台。该系统旨在提高毕业设计(论文)管理的效率,规范毕业设计(论文)的各个环节,确保毕业设计(论文)的质量。系统涵盖了从选题申报、开题报告、中期检查、论文撰写、答辩评审到成绩评定等全部流程,实现了对学生、教师、管理员等多角色的有效管理。
(2)系统采用模块化设计,分为学生模块、教师模块、管理员模块和系统维护模块。学生模块主要提供选题申报、进度跟踪、论文提交、答辩预约等功能;教师模块主要负责选题审核、开题报告审批、中期检查、论文评阅、答辩安排等任务;管理员模块负责系统设置、用户管理、数据统计和分析等;系统维护模块则用于系统更新、故障排除和性能优化。各模块之间相互独立,又相互协作,共同构成了一个完整的管理体系。
(3)维普毕业设计(论文)管理系统具备以下特点:一是智能化,通过智能推荐、智能查重等功能,辅助学生完成论文撰写;二是便捷性,用户可通过电脑或移动设备随时随地访问系统,进行各项操作;三是安全性,系统采用多层次的安全防护措施,确保用户数据的安全性和完整性;四是可扩展性,系统可根据实际需求进行功能扩展和升级,满足不同高校的个性化需求。总之,该系统为高校毕业设计(论文)管理提供了一套高效、便捷、安全的解决方案。
二、系统需求分析
系统需求分析
(1)在进行维普毕业设计(论文)管理系统需求分析时,首先需要明确系统的目标用户群体,包括学生、教师、学院管理人员以及系统管理员。学生需要通过系统完成选题申报、论文撰写、进度跟踪、答辩预约等任务;教师需要通过系统进行选题审核、开题报告审批、中期检查、论文评阅、答辩安排等工作;学院管理人员负责对整个学院的毕业设计(论文)过程进行监控和管理;系统管理员则负责系统的日常维护和升级。针对这些用户的需求,系统需具备以下功能:
-用户身份认证与权限管理:系统应提供用户登录功能,确保用户能够根据其角色访问相应的功能模块。同时,系统应具备权限管理功能,防止未经授权的用户访问敏感信息。
-选题申报与管理:系统应支持学生在线申报选题,教师在线审核选题,并允许管理员对选题进行管理和调整。
-论文撰写与提交:系统应提供在线论文撰写环境,支持文档编辑、格式检查、查重等功能,并允许学生在线提交论文。
-论文评阅与答辩管理:系统应支持教师在线评阅论文,提供评分和评语功能,同时支持答辩安排和成绩评定。
-进度跟踪与统计:系统应提供进度跟踪功能,允许用户查看自己的任务进度,并生成各类统计报表,便于学院管理人员进行数据分析。
(2)在功能需求的基础上,系统还需满足以下性能需求:
-系统响应速度:系统应保证用户在操作过程中能够快速响应,尤其是在高并发情况下,系统应保持稳定运行。
-数据存储与备份:系统应具备高效的数据存储机制,确保数据的安全性和可靠性,并定期进行数据备份,以防数据丢失。
-系统扩展性:系统设计应考虑未来可能的扩展需求,如增加新的功能模块、支持更多用户等,确保系统可扩展性。
-系统兼容性:系统应兼容主流的操作系统、浏览器和移动设备,确保不同用户群体能够顺畅使用。
(3)安全性和可靠性是系统需求分析中的重要方面。系统应具备以下安全特性:
-用户认证与权限控制:系统应采用强密码策略,并支持多因素认证,确保用户身份的准确性。同时,系统应设置严格的权限控制机制,防止未经授权的用户访问敏感信息。
-数据加密与传输安全:系统应采用加密技术对用户数据进行加密存储和传输,防止数据泄露和篡改。
-系统日志与审计:系统应记录用户操作日志,便于追踪和审计,确保系统运行的可追溯性。
-系统备份与恢复:系统应定期进行数据备份,并制定详细的恢复计划,确保在发生故障时能够迅速恢复系统运行。
三、系统设计
系统设计
(1)在系统设计阶段,我们采用了B/S架构,即浏览器/服务器架构,以确保系统的跨平台性和易用性。系统分为前端和后端两部分,前端采用HTML5、CSS3和JavaScript等技术实现用户界面,后端则使用Java语言和SpringBoot框架构建,以MySQL数据库作为数据存储。为了提高系统的性能和稳定性,我们采用了以下设计策略:
-数据库设计:根据需求分析,数据库共包含10个表,如学生信息表、教师信息表、选题信息表、论文信息表等。每个表都经过精心设计,保证了数据的完整性和一致性。例如,学生信息表包含学生ID、姓名、学号、班级等字段,共计1000条记录。
-系统安全性设计:为了保障用户数据的安全,我们采用了HTTPS协议进行数据传输加密,并设置了严格的用户权限管理。系统支持多级权限控制,如学院管理员、系主任、教师和学生,不同角色的用户只能访问其权限范围内的功能。
-系统
文档评论(0)